This form is a warrant to enforce a lien on a tenant's personal property with regard to a commercial lease.

Title: Understanding the Hillsborough Florida Warrant for Distraint of Tenant's Personality to Secure Payment of Rent Description: In Hillsborough, Florida, landlords have legal recourse in cases where tenants fail to pay their rent. One such measure is the Hillsborough Florida Warrant for Distraint of Tenant's Personality to Secure Payment of Rent, a legal action that allows landlords to seize and sell the tenant's personal property to recover the unpaid rent. A Warrant for Distraint of Tenant's Personality is a powerful tool that provides landlords with a means to enforce rent collection while safeguarding their rights. This process follows a series of legal steps outlined in Florida's landlord-tenant laws. Diving into the specifics, landlords must follow the correct protocol to obtain a Hillsborough Florida Warrant for Distraint of Tenant's Personality. They must first file and serve a Three-Day Notice of Nonpayment of Rent to the tenant, highlighting the overdue rent amount. If the tenant fails to pay within the designated three days, the landlord can proceed with the next step. After the three-day notice period expires, the landlord may file a Complaint for Distraint of Tenant's Personality at the local courthouse. The complaint should include vital information such as the tenant's name, the rental property address, and the overdue rent amount. Upon filing the complaint, the court will review the case and, if satisfied, issue a Warrant for Distraint of Tenant's Personality to the landlord. Once the warrant is obtained, the landlord gains the right to enter the tenant's rental unit and seize any personal property that can be sold to recover the unpaid rent. However, it's important to note that certain personal property, such as essential household goods, may be exempt from seizure.
